Transaction 4a18d77089087ab3aa2c682fef0857056d4f157344587e67eabf9aebfd934413
1 Input
1 Output
-
4a18d77089087ab3aa2c682fef0857056d4f157344587e67eabf9aebfd934413:0
- value
- 66943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15f9158e9f707a0e2a7003f34a236c639240f345 OP_EQUAL
- address
- 33hCWFEvofmN9tuibd3wonc7aYaJCqv3ZT